"""
Core training engine — single function used by all experiments.
Handles: LR schedule (warmup + cosine), online data generation,
loss computation (lejepa or whiten), periodic evaluation of ALL metrics
on a fixed eval set, standardized output schema.
"""
import torch
import numpy as np
from .losses import SIGReg, whitening_loss, alignment_loss, infonce_loss
from .data import sample_latents, ou_augment
from .metrics import compute_all_metrics
def warmup_cosine_lr(step, total_steps, base_lr):
"""Constant for first half, cosine decay for second half."""
warmup = total_steps // 2
if step < warmup:
return base_lr
t = (step - warmup) / (total_steps - warmup)
return base_lr * 0.5 * (1 + np.cos(np.pi * t))
def train_and_evaluate(
encoder,
mix_fn,
*,
N,
rho,
lamb,
sigma=1.0,
mode="lejepa",
source_dist="gaussian",
source_alpha=None,
steps=20000,
batch_size=256,
lr=3e-3,
z_eval,
log_every=100,
device="cuda",
):
"""Train encoder and evaluate periodically.
Args:
encoder: nn.Module, x -> h
mix_fn: callable, z -> x
N: latent dimension
rho: OU correlation
lamb: regularization weight
mode: "lejepa" or "whiten"
source_dist: "gaussian", "laplace", or "gennorm"
steps: total training steps
batch_size: batch size (online data)
lr: peak learning rate
z_eval: (num_eval, N) fixed eval tensor
log_every: eval frequency
device: torch device string
Returns:
encoder: trained encoder
log: dict of lists — training curves and periodic eval metrics
"""
sigreg = SIGReg().to(device)
opt = torch.optim.AdamW(encoder.parameters(), lr=lr)
# Precompute eval mixing (constant across training)
x_eval = mix_fn(z_eval)
log_keys = [
"step", "lr",
# training losses
"align", "sigreg", "whiten", "total",
# eval metrics
"r2_zx", "r2_xz", "r2_zh", "r2_hz",
"orth_err", "orth_err_normalized",
"epsilon", "delta", "D_bound", "approx_bound",
"procrustes_mse", "L_h", "trace_cov",
]
log = {k: [] for k in log_keys}
for step in range(steps + 1):
# LR schedule
current_lr = warmup_cosine_lr(step, steps, lr)
for pg in opt.param_groups:
pg["lr"] = current_lr
# Online data
z_batch = sample_latents(batch_size, N, dist=source_dist,
device=device, alpha=source_alpha)
z_aug = ou_augment(z_batch, rho, dist=source_dist, alpha=source_alpha) # (2, B, N)
h = encoder(mix_fn(z_aug).flatten(0, 1)).reshape(2, batch_size, N)
align = alignment_loss(h)
sig = sigreg(h)
wht = whitening_loss(h)
if mode == "lejepa":
loss = lamb * sig + (1 - lamb) * align
elif mode == "whiten":
loss = lamb * wht + (1 - lamb) * align
elif mode == "infonce":
loss = infonce_loss(h, sigma)
else:
raise ValueError(f"Unknown mode: {mode}")
opt.zero_grad()
loss.backward()
opt.step()
if step % log_every == 0 or (step < 1000 and step % 100 == 0):
log["step"].append(step)
log["lr"].append(current_lr)
log["align"].append(align.item())
log["sigreg"].append(sig.item())
log["whiten"].append(wht.item())
log["total"].append(loss.item())
# Full eval on fixed set
encoder.eval()
with torch.no_grad():
h_eval = encoder(x_eval)
z_prime = ou_augment(
z_eval, rho, n_views=1,
dist=source_dist, alpha=source_alpha
).squeeze(0)
h_prime = encoder(mix_fn(z_prime))
metrics = compute_all_metrics(z_eval, x_eval, h_eval, h_prime, rho, N)
for k, v in metrics.items():
log[k].append(v)
encoder.train()
if step % (log_every * 10) == 0:
print(f" step {step:5d} | lr={current_lr:.1e} "
f"align={align.item():.2e} sig={sig.item():.1f} "
f"R²(h->z)={metrics['r2_hz']:.4f} "
f"orth={metrics['orth_err']:.4f}")
return encoder, log
